L'Artha is a French restaurant in Saint-Jean-de-Luz that specializes in traditional French cuisine with an emphasis on seafood. The kitchen prepares fish soup, calamari, and regional specialties from the Basque area.
Saint-Jean-de-Luz grew as a major fishing port and center of maritime trade along the French Basque coast. The town's rich seafaring past continues to shape the region's culinary traditions today.
The menu includes axoa de veau, a traditional Basque preparation of minced veal with local spices that reflects the culinary roots of this border region. This dish represents how the kitchen honors cooking traditions passed down through generations in the Basque community.
